Designing of Co(0.5)Ni(0.5)Ga(x)Fe(2−x)O(4) (0.0 ≤ x ≤ 1.0) Microspheres via Hydrothermal Approach and Their Selective Inhibition on the Growth of Cancerous and Fungal Cells
The current study offers an efficient design of novel nanoparticle microspheres (MCs) using a hydrothermal approach.
